
A MAJOR arterial road outside Wagga was closed in both directions on Wednesday afternoon after a serious collision.
The accident occurred about 3.30pm on the Sturt Highway, on the Tarcutta Creek bridge.
Four people were treated for minor injuries in the two-car accident, while a 22-year-old male passenger was taken to hospital with non-life threatening head, limb and chest injuries.
There were seven people involved in the accident.
NSW Ambulance Wagga zone commander Eamon Purcell said the 22-year-old was trapped in the back seat of one of the vehicles, and needed to be cut free.
The Sturt Highway turn-off from the Hume Highway had been temporarily closed, and diversions were in place on Mates Gully Road, via Tarcutta.
